Steamboat Springs, CO, May 7, 2015—Bella Vista, a seven-acre rental property in northern Colorado, will be featured next month on The Real Housewives of Atlanta: Kandi’s Ski Trip.  This three-episode special is a highly anticipated spinoff of the regular series and will showcase Kandi Burruss and Todd Tucker’s extended families as they take a week long vacation to the Rocky Mountains.

 

“It’s time to mend, and blend, and come together with friends,” sings Kandi in Bravo’s exclusive trailer featured on E! Online.  “We've never had Kandi and my family under the same roof, so it was an interesting experiment with lots of unexpected moments," commented her new husband in the report.

 

During a time when Steamboat Springs is gaining more attention (NY Times ranked its Hot Springs #19 in its 52 places to visit globally), this mini series will be sure to prove the town has much more to offer than a ski resort.  The family enjoyed luxurious accommodations at Bella Vista Estate, handmade beauty products from Rising Sun Ranch Creations, craft beer from Butcherknife Brewery, and traditional Western gear while shopping at FM Light

 

“It takes a village,” says David Josfan, owner of the vacation compound that served as a home base for the show.  “We are extremely grateful to all of the local businesses who helped us bring in a national television network and give the cast and crew an authentic experience.”  He and his wife, Alicia, have made efforts in the past year to attract more clients from Hollywood, as Bella Vista’s amenities are ideal for celebrities who demand privacy.  The couple has perfected large group lodging in the mountains with their unique rental.  “This sanctuary is the ultimate location for family reunions, destination weddings, spiritual gatherings, and other special interest groups, so it seemed only natural that we invite red carpet stars to come enjoy the magic of Bella Vista,” comments the Josfans.   “We’re reinventing how people want to vacation—our home offers such respite.” 

 

After meeting the owners in November 2014 at the American Music Awards (certificates to Bella Vista ware a main highlight in the official gifting suite), Kandi encouraged Bravo to film the prized resort getaway.  The first episode will air Sunday, May 17, 2015.
